How Much Does Gate Repair Cost in Camarillo?
Gate repair in Camarillo typically costs between $180 and $450 for standard mechanical adjustments or sensor alignments, while major component replacements like motors or control boards range from $650 to $1,800. Gate Repair Cost Breakdown (2026)
When we assess a gate system, we break costs down by the specific component that has failed. The following ranges reflect the current market costs in Camarillo for parts and labor.
| Service Item | Estimated Cost Range |
|---|---|
| Standard Sensor Alignment | $180 - $240 |
| Limit Switch Adjustment & Calibration | $210 - $280 |
| Gate Hinge Welding & Reinforcement | $250 - $450 |
| Control Board Replacement | $650 - $1,100 |
| Gate Motor/Operator Replacement | $900 - $1,800+ |
| Battery Backup System Installation | $350 - $550 |
These figures are estimates based on standard residential gate configurations. Factors such as the brand of your operator-whether it is a LiftMaster, FAAC, BFT, Linear, Viking, Ghost Controls, DoorKing, Elite, or Mighty Mule-can influence the cost of replacement parts. What Affects Gate Repair Pricing in Camarillo

Understanding what drives the cost of your repair helps you make an informed decision when your gate stops functioning. In Camarillo, we often see specific conditions that influence the complexity of a repair.
- Brand-Specific Hardware: Replacing a board on a Viking operator often involves different programming protocols compared to a DoorKing system. We stock parts for nine major brands to keep your gate running without waiting on special orders.
- Structural Integrity: If a gate has been dragging or hitting the pavement, the hinge or post may require welding. We assess the structural load before recommending a simple adjustment, as correcting the alignment is often cheaper than replacing a motor burned out by resistance.
- Accessibility and Clearance: Some residential properties in areas like Camarillo Springs or the hillsides have limited clearance for equipment. We account for the physical labor required to safely access the operator box without damaging your driveway or landscaping.
- Age of the System: Older systems often require custom fabrication if original parts are no longer manufactured. We prioritize repair over replacement, but we will document the condition of your gears and chains so you can see if the cost of repair is approaching the cost of a modern, more efficient unit.
- Safety and Code Compliance: Modern safety standards require operational photo-eyes and reverse sensors. If your gate is an older model that lacks these, we may need to integrate them during a repair to ensure the system meets current safety requirements.

How much does it cost to fix a gate that won’t close in Camarillo?
Most gate closure issues in Camarillo are caused by misaligned photo-eyes or incorrect limit switch settings, which typically cost between $180 and $280 to diagnose and repair. If the issue is a failed control board or a damaged motor, the cost will be higher, but we will provide a written quote for the repair before we start.
Is it cheaper to repair or replace a gate motor?
In most cases, it is significantly cheaper to repair a gate motor than to replace the entire system, provided the core chassis and gearing are in good condition.
